NSUI activists show black flags to Union Minister Gajendra Singh Shekhawat in Jaisalmer today while harassing Rahul Gandhi by ED and protesting against Agneepath scheme. During this period, police force was deployed in heavy numbers on Pokaran Highway. But the Congress workers were not ready to listen to anyone. It is said that he also threw black ink on Shekhawat.
According to a report, Union Jal Shakti Minister Gajendra Singh Shekhawat had come to Jaisalmer on Tuesday on the occasion of International Yoga Day. He did yoga with the people there. On his way from Jaisalmer to Jodhpur, NSUI workers showed him black flags and threw black ink on his vehicle. People associated with the matter said that Congress workers were already standing on the Pokaran Highway.
It can be clearly seen in a video that he is running behind Shekhawat’s car. He was even trying to stop them. Police personnel are seen running on the highway to stop them. However, Shekhawat’s convoy on seeing the youth went ahead rapidly.
NSUI District President Bhom Singh said that we protested by showing black flags to Union Minister Gajendra Singh’s convoy and throwing black ink on his vehicle. He told that this protest is against harassing Rahul Gandhi through ED and against Agneepath scheme. He told that the minister did not listen to us.
